Rashtriya Chemicals & Fertilizers (RCF), a notable player in the fertilizers sector, has recently experienced an adjustment in its evaluation by MarketsMOJO. This revision comes in light of the company's financial performance for the second quarter of FY24-25, which has shown a flat trajectory. While interest surged by 45.90% to Rs 146.47 crore, a significant portion of profit before tax—40.05%—stemmed from non-operating income, raising questions about the sustainability of its earnings.

RCF's return on capital employed (ROCE) is currently at 6.5, reflecting a high valuation, as evidenced by an enterprise value to capital employed ratio of 1.9. Over the past year, the stock has delivered a modest return of 3.69%, but profits have taken a substantial hit, declining by 57.1%. The minimal stake of just 0.33% held by domestic mutual funds further indicates a cautious sentiment regarding the company's valuation and future business outlook.

Despite these challenges, RCF has demonstrated healthy long-term growth, with net sales increasing at an annual rate of 12.99% and operating profit rising by 35.64%. However, the technical trend for the stock remains sideways, suggesting a lack of clear price momentum. In light of these factors, RCF has been added to MarketsMOJO's list, reflecting the ongoing scrutiny of its market position and performance indicators.
